76ers vs Grizzlies best bet: Jaren Jackson Jr. Over 20.5 points (-120)
It’s been another turbulent season for the Memphis Grizzlies, but Jaren Jackson Jr. is doing his best to steady the ship. He’s appeared in 30 of the Grizzlies’ 32 games, and is in the middle of a strong scoring push to keep his team within range of the .500 mark.
JJJ finished with 31 points on 11-for-25 shooting in Sunday’s disappointing loss to the Washington Wizards, and he’s now gone past this O/U number in six of his last seven outings. This line feels too low, and I’m jumping on the value for tonight’s matchup with the Philadelphia 76ers.
Ja Morant’s return certainly helps. Instead of creating all of his opportunities himself, Jackson is walking into open looks when his point guard attacks the paint, and he’s also found his stroke from beyond the arc, making 16 of his past 34 attempts from deep.
The 76ers are sweating on Joel Embiid’s availability, and they’re coming off a blowout loss to the Oklahoma City Thunder, where they gave up 129 points.
Andre Drummond certainly won’t want to be matched up with Jackson on the perimeter, and I see the former Defensive Player of the Year cashing in with another efficient scoring night here.

76ers vs Grizzlies same-game parlay
The Under has been a solid pick for both these teams in their last 10 games, particularly for the Grizzlies, who are 6-3-1 in that span. While Memphis has been erratic offensively, the 76ers have scored fewer than 110 points in three straight contests. Whether Embiid plays or not, I see the total tilting toward the Under.
VJ Edgecombe has had an explosive start to his NBA career, but he’s still finding his role in a full-strength Philly rotation. With Tyrese Maxey and Paul George dominating possessions, I’ll take the Under on this Edgecombe prop, with the rookie scoring 10 points in each of his last two games.
